Abstract :
A ´load conditioner´ is defined as a small-scale battery energy storage system, which stores night time electricity and provides power for daytime demand. A 5 kW advanced load conditioner has been developed, which is applicable to a single-phase three-wire power line and is connectible with photovoltaic cells. The load conditioner can transfer the excess photovoltaic power either to the power line or to the storage battery. It can not only guarantee a high-quality interconnection with a power line by means of an active filter but can also be a high reliability uninterruptible power supply to specific loads.<>
